Maggie’s Cabaret 2
50th Anniversary Special
Presented by Motte & Bailey, prod.
Featuring The Woodsluts and Special Guest
Dame Jacqueline Thunderfüq
January 24, 2026 - 8pm
at Fells Point Corner Theatre
A benefit event for Special Olympics Sailing, and Motte & Bailey, prod.
It's an annual tradition that's been with you for half a century or more, and this year promises to be one of our best! Join Motte & Bailey, prod. for a musical evening of merriment and mirth as we celebrate this faux anniversary of 50 years honoring our beloved friend Maggie Flanigan and supporting Special Olympics Sailing programs! Year after year, we've brought you musical guests and entertainment from Broadway and beyond, and this year we dive dance belt first into that most magical of eras, the 70's and 80's. We've assembled some of the finest musical theatre talents from across the Mid-Atlantic and they've got magic to do, barricades to build, and so much of gay Paree to pack into one fantastical evening! All that jazz and more can be found somewhere that's green at Maggie's Cabaret!
This year's cabaret features the musical stylings of our house band, The Woodsluts, along with special guest star, Dame Jacqueline Thunderfüq!!! Baltimore's own iconic queer diva, Dame Jacqueline Thunderdüq, will return to the stage to perform a selection from her upcoming Valentine's Gay Cabaret featuring songs that your parents used to fuck to. This year’s spectacle will take place at Fells Point Corner Theatre on Saturday, January 24, 2026 at 8pm. Tickets are $20 each and can be purchased in advance at motteandbailey.org.
All proceeds from the evening will go to benefit Special Olympics Sailing and the continued work of Motte & Bailey, prod.
Fells Point Corner Theatre is located at 251 S. Ann Street in the Upper Fells Point neighborhood of Baltimore.
